Thingvellir National Park

The first stop will be at Thingvellir National Park, where Iceland's first parliament was established and which is a UNESCO World Heritage Site. You will have the opportunity to walk and explore the surroundings on your own and see the rift that divides the Eurasian and North American continental plates.

Kerid Volcanic Crater

On the way back, you will stop at Kerid, a volcanic crater known for its vibrant contrast of colors. This crater is 6,500 years old and is, without a doubt, the perfect detour from the Golden Circle. Kerid is part of the Western Volcanic Zone that includes the Reykjanes Peninsula and the Langjökull Glacier, making it one of the three most recognizable volcanic craters in Iceland.
